Man City Vs Man Utd: Rangnick Reveals Player To Join His Squad

Manchester United interim manager, Ralf Rangnick, has said he is expecting to have Edinson Cavani available for the trip to Manchester City on Sunday.
The Uruguay striker who has not played for the Red Devils since the 1-1 draw at Burnley on February 8 because of a groin injury, has returned to full training with the rest of the squad ahead of the derby.
Rangnick said: “He has been back in training since yesterday [Thursday].

“Today was his second session. He looks good so I think he could at least be part of the group for Sunday.
“There are two or three question marks behind some players and we will have to wait and see what happens. Edinson as it stands now will be part of the group.”
